Samsung All In One PC

Hoping to tap into a newly emerging market, Samsung are in the process of releasing two new “All-In-One” style computers.  From the pictures we have seen, it is not quite an all in one, instead consisting of a screen (complete with the required computing innards, obviously!) and a separate keyboard and mouse.  These input devices, though, are not strictly necessary since the product will be touch-enabled via Windows 7’s new Multi-Touch API.
It does look like a very chic design, too, and it comes in two flavours.  The U200 ships with a 20-inch screen and the U250 has a 23-inch unit.  Both models support “FullHD” at a resolution of 1600 x 900 pixels.
The actual PC-side specifications are not yet known, but boutique-style PC’s such as these are always more about style than substance, so we would not expect barnstorming performance for the outlay.  Having said this, and given the anticipated price point of “circa £1500” we would expect respectable core specifications to be driving this classy little number.
